Condividi tramite


AppNotificationBuilder.SetTimeStamp(DateTime) Metodo

Definizione

Imposta il timestamp personalizzato per una notifica dell'app.

public:
 virtual AppNotificationBuilder ^ SetTimeStamp(DateTime value) = SetTimeStamp;
AppNotificationBuilder SetTimeStamp(DateTime const& value);
public AppNotificationBuilder SetTimeStamp(System.DateTimeOffset value);
function setTimeStamp(value)
Public Function SetTimeStamp (value As DateTimeOffset) As AppNotificationBuilder

Parametri

value
DateTime DateTimeOffset

Valore DateTimeOffset che specifica il valore per il timestamp personalizzato.

Restituisce

Restituisce l'istanza di AppNotificationBuilder in modo che sia possibile concatenare altre chiamate al metodo.

Esempio

Nell'esempio seguente viene illustrato l'impostazione del timestamp personalizzato nel payload XML per una notifica dell'app.

var notification = new AppNotificationBuilder()
    .AddText("Notification text.")
    .SetTimeStamp(DateTimeOffset.Now)
    .BuildNotification();

AppNotificationManager.Default.Show(notification);

Payload XML risultante:

<toast displayTimestamp='2022-10-25T15:54:31-07:00'>
    <visual>
        <binding template='ToastGeneric'>
            <text>Notification text.</text>
        </binding>
    </visual>
</toast>

Commenti

Lo screenshot seguente illustra il posizionamento del timestamp personalizzato.

Screenshot di una notifica dell'app con un timestamp personalizzato.

Per indicazioni sull'uso delle API AppNotificationBuilder per creare l'interfaccia utente per le notifiche dell'app, vedere Contenuto di notifica dell'app.

Per informazioni di riferimento sullo schema XML per le notifiche dell'app, vedere Schema del contenuto di notifica dell'app.

Si applica a